Exploring Career Options and Job Roles
Are you at a crossroads in your career and looking to explore different job roles? Understanding the vast array of career options available can be overwhelming, but with the right approach, you can discover a path that aligns with your skills, interests, and aspirations. Let's delve into some strategies for exploring various career options and uncovering potential job roles.
1. Self-Assessment
Begin by conducting a self-assessment to identify your strengths, weaknesses, interests, values, and goals. Reflect on your past experiences, achievements, and what motivates you. Tools like career assessment quizzes can also provide insights into suitable career paths based on your personality and preferences.
2. Research Industries and Job Trends
Explore different industries to understand their growth potential, job demand, and future outlook. Look into emerging fields such as technology, healthcare, sustainability, and digital marketing. Research job trends to identify roles that are in high demand and align with your skills and interests.
3. Networking
Expand your professional network by connecting with industry professionals, attending career fairs, and joining online communities related to your areas of interest. Networking can provide valuable insights into various job roles, company cultures, and career paths. Reach out to professionals for informational interviews to learn more about their roles and experiences.
4. Skill Development
Identify any skill gaps that may be hindering your career progression and invest in skill development. Consider enrolling in online courses, workshops, or certifications to enhance your skills and make yourself more marketable to potential employers. Soft skills such as communication, leadership, and problem-solving are also crucial for career advancement.
5. Internships and Job Shadowing
Gain hands-on experience in different job roles through internships or job shadowing opportunities. This firsthand experience can provide valuable insights into the day-to-day responsibilities of various roles and help you determine if a specific career path is the right fit for you.
6. Career Counseling
If you're struggling to identify suitable career options or job roles, consider seeking guidance from a career counselor or coach. They can help you explore your interests, values, and strengths, and provide personalized career advice based on your unique profile.
7. Stay Flexible and Open-Minded
Keep an open mind during your career exploration journey and be willing to consider unconventional paths or roles that may not have been on your radar initially. Embrace new opportunities for growth and learning, and don't be afraid to pivot if your career interests evolve over time.
